Output e24addf95eb8d29cc6dcbc4e5285a2e3632013334afedfda744b9f96e7bc0918:0

value
21836362
script pubkey
OP_0 OP_PUSHBYTES_20 ff7d436399fa054c569257bc55a4a4fa0d2e835c
address
bc1qla75xcuelgz5c45j2779tf9ylgxjaq6uhf6c7t
transaction
e24addf95eb8d29cc6dcbc4e5285a2e3632013334afedfda744b9f96e7bc0918
confirmations
59690
spent
true